The Home Depot, Inc. operates as a prominent retailer specializing in home renovation and improvement. Through its expansive network of "The Home Depot" stores, it furnishes consumers with an extensive array of goods, including building materials, home enhancement products, lawn and garden supplies, decorative items, and facilities maintenance, repair, and operational (MRO) supplies.     The Home Depot Announces Interim Management Plans While CEO Takes Temporary Medical Leave ATLANTA, Aug. 12, 2026 /PRNewswire/ -- The Home Depot®, the world's largest home improvement retailer, today announced that chair, president and CEO Ted Decker will take a temporary medical leave of absence. The company expects Decker to return within the next few months.
